Our marriage was just based on a contract anyway. I didn’t even care who Gideon married.

Their wedding buzzed online.

Riding the tide, Vesper started a vlog to share their preparations.

When Maren showed it to me, I set down my papers. “Are you so idle now?”

She snickered, “Just sharing the gossip.”

I glanced at her phone and quickly looked away. She added, “Gideon does spoil her.”

I said nothing.

Before leaving, Maren suddenly asked, “You divorced him yet?”

I paused. “The lawyer says Gideon doesn’t agree. I don’t know what’s up, but I’ll deal with

it later.”

“Maybe he can’t let you go,” Maren teased, running off.

I chewed over her words but soon dismissed them.

Gideon was a selfish businessman. I made his life easyso he’d pay to keep me. My refusal hurt his pride, and marrying Vesper was his way to lure me back.
